
Hydraulic clamps are one of the most powerful hydraulic tools designed for effective power workholding. A
clamp is a device used to join, grip, support, or compress mechanical or
structural parts. Its opposing and often adjustable parts provide for bracing objects or
holding them together. The hydraulic clamps ensure a powerful and
consistent clamping force and enable components to be loaded and
unloaded simply and quickly at the press of a button.

The three basic functions of hydraulic clamps are:
- Position the component accurately.
- Support the component adequately.
- Clamp the component securely for machining.
Types of Hydraulic Clamps
Swing Hydraulic Clamps: Swing hydraulic clamps are used to provide maximum reach and clearance for loading and unloading. They have a rotating arm which swings over workpieces to clamp, then swings out of the way using hydraulic mechanism.
Edge Hydraulic Clamps: Using hydraulic technology, the edge clamps apply force forward and down when clamping from above.
Push Hydraulic Clamps:Push clamps deliver high locating forces in a compact design which lets close positioning of multiple units.
Block Hydraulic Clamps:Block hydraulic clamps are ideal for punching and assembly operations. They are functional clamps which deliver high forces with push or pull action.
Extending Hydraulic Clamps: Extending hydraulic clamps are considered the most compact downholding clamps available. They are used for clamping in narrow recesses, their arm moves forward, then straight down to clamp.
Flat Pivot Clamps: Flat clamps as the name suggest are designed for clamping flat workpieces on machine tools and for welding applications.
Hydraulic Clamping Technology: Advantages
Hydraulic Clamping technology has some advantages over other varieties of clamps:
- The main benefit is that hydraulic clamping reduces downtime thereby increasing productivity and maximising capacity utilization.
- Hydraulic positioning and clamping is an extremely reliable and efficient technique.
- The major advantage of hydraulic clamping is the enormous time saved in clamping and unclamping the components.
- There is precise positioning and clamping using hydraulic clamps.
- Another great advantage is that it makes optimum use of clamping space because of compact standard components. It also can clamp in manually inaccessible areas. As a result the number of components to be clamped can be increased and processed simultaneously on one fixture.
What to look for in hydraulic clamps: Selection tips
- The clamping stroke and force of the hydraulic cylinders
- The power source
- The control of the clamping system (valves and other accessories)
